Changelog for
icecast-2.4.99.1-4.6.i686.rpm :
Wed Dec 31 13:00:00 2014 Thomas B. Ruecker
- 2.4.99.1-1 - Icecast 2.5 beta1 - see ChangeLog for details Sun Dec 14 13:00:00 2014 Thomas B. Ruecker - 2.4.1-2 - Packaging fix for docdir problem, as patched upstream - Adjusted doc entries to reflect subdirectories Sun Nov 23 13:00:00 2014 Thomas B. Ruecker - 2.4.1-1 - Initial packaging of 2.4.1 - SECURITY FIX - See ChangeLog for details Sun May 25 14:00:00 2014 Thomas B. Ruecker - 2.4.0-1 - SECURITY FIX - Override supplementary groups if - Added for supported streams. TNX ePirat - status2.xsl, broken for a decade, now it\'s gone! - Updated docs: - logging to STDERR; known issues - Refactored docs about client authentication - Vastly improved page about Icecast statistics - Clean up supported windows versions - Quick fixup of the basic setup page - Minor fixes to the config file documentation - Updated YP documentation - Reduced win32 documentation to essentials - Adding stream_start_iso8601, server_start_iso8601 ISO8601 compliante timestamps for statistics. Should make usage in e.g. JSON much easier. Added as new variables to avoid breaking backwards compatibility. - Nicer looking tables for the admin interface. ePirat sent updated tables code that should look much nicer. This is admin interface only (and a global css change). - Set content-type to official \"application/json\" - Initial JSON status transform. Output roughly limited to data also visible through status.xsl. - Silence direct calls, add partial array support. - The XSLT will now return empty if called directly. This is a security measure to prevent unintended data leakage. - Adding partial array support to print sources in an array. Code lifted from: https://code.google.com/p/xml2json-xslt/issues/detail?id=3 - Adding xml2json XSLT, svn r31 upstream trunk. https://code.google.com/p/xml2json-xslt/ - RPM specific changes: - remove status3.xsl as it was never part of the official source - slight change in default config, more changes later Sat Mar 1 13:00:00 2014 Thomas B. Ruecker - 2.3.99.5-1 - Upgrade to 2.4 beta5 - Updated web interface to be fully XHTML compliant. Credit to ePirat - Send charset in headers for everything, excluding file-serv and streams. - Documentation updates - reverted patch affecting stats interface Thu Jan 23 13:00:00 2014 Thomas B. Ruecker - 2.3.99.4-1 - Upgrade to 2.4 beta4 - Updated web interface to be more XHTML compliant. - Fixed a memory leak. Lost headers of stream because of wrong ref counter in associated refbuf objects. - avoid memory leak in _parse_mount() when \"type\"-attribute is set - Completed HTTP PUT support, send 100-continue-header, if client requests it. We need to adhere to HTTP1.1 here. - corrected Date-header format to conform the standard (see RFC1123). Thanks to cato for reporting. - Added a favicon to the web-root content - We now split handling of command line arguments into two parts. Only the critical part of getting the config file is done first (and -v as it prevents startup). The rest (currently only -b) is deferred. It allows us to log error messages to stderr even if the -b argument is passed. This is mainly for the case where the logfile or TCP port can\'t be opened. Sat Apr 6 14:00:00 2013 Thomas B. Ruecker - 2.3.99.3-1 - Upgrade to 2.4 beta3 - This release added a default mount feature Sun Mar 31 14:00:00 2013 Thomas B. Ruecker - 2.3.99.2-1 - Experimental packaging of Icecast 2.4 beta2